Sebi asks exchanges dealing in agri-commodity derivatives to create fund for farmers, FPOs
In September last year, the regulator had decided to levy a nominal fee of Rs 1 lakh per exchange instead of levying charges based on turnover slab rates and proposed to set up a fund with the fee foregone by it.
